Heated exchanges at Gandhi Bhavan

By Our Special Correspondent

HYDERABAD, JULY 2. Heated exchanges were witnessed between Mrs. Renuka Chowdary, MP, and senior Congress leaders in Gandhi Bhavan on Monday on the question of selecting party candidates from Khammam district for the mandal and zilla parishad elections.

It was a fall-out of a protest lodged by party MLAs from Khammam that the list of candidates she had submitted had been approved by the PCC leadership. This ran contrary to the earlier assurance given by the leadership to leave the choice of candidates entirely to the MLAs.

Messrs. S. Chandrasekhar, R. Venkat Reddy and Younis Sultan, Congress MLAs from Khammam district, met the PCC president, Mr. M. Satyanarayana Rao, and the CLP leader, Dr. Y. S. Rajasekhara Reddy, today to demand scrapping of the list given by Mrs. Chowdary. The leaders invited the Khammam MP to Gandhi Bhavan to discuss the matter. During the discussion, Mrs. Chowdary reportedly got upset over the attempt to change her list and walked out from the meeting after exchanging angry remarks with the MLAs. The Congress MLAs returned to their districts after the leadership changed some candidates to their satisfaction.
